Transaction 8a9b119c79329a92f349ab158c8400a4c93093fcaeb0268f6c12bc1be75a58fd

4 Input
1 Outputs
  • 8a9b119c79329a92f349ab158c8400a4c93093fcaeb0268f6c12bc1be75a58fd:0
  • value  7545939
    address  1PdWsdFMwLtWEsoYTdEEV8HWiHrocbR89p